Necklace Buying Guide: Detailed Explanation of 10 Common Types of Chains
❤️Today, we bring you 10 common types of jewelry chains. Come and take a look!
1. Snake bone chain
Snake chain is soft and has a unique luster, making it sparkle when worn.
2. O-chain
Composed of multiple O-shaped links, it is one of the most common types of necklaces and can be paired with various pendants.
3. Twisted chain
The chain is made of multiple interlocking rings, making it more durable and dynamic, and less likely to tangle with hair.
4. Cuban Chain
The chain resembles a braid, with links tightly interlocked in layers.
5. Bead Chain
The entire necklace is composed of multiple shiny beads, making it visually appealing even when worn without a pendant.
6. Chopin Chain
Chopin chains are interlocked, efficiently utilizing space to maximize the number of links connected.
7. Box Chain
Box chains have a large reflective surface, making them very shiny. However, since they are hollow, they are lightweight and not suitable for heavy pendants.
8. Dragon Bone Chain
The chain links are thicker and arranged at sharp angles, resembling a dragon's spine. It is suitable for wearing alone or with a large pendant.
9. Tile Chain
Composed of multiple components shaped like tiles, it is highly reflective and features an artistic curvature.
10. Ingot Chain
Composed of components shaped like ingots, it is reflective and symbolizes wealth and prosperity.
